Code of Conduct

Modified on Sat, 23 Nov, 2024 at 10:22 PM

Driving Instructor Agreement



1. Scope and Agreement


1.1. This Code of Conduct ("Code") applies to all driving instructors ("Instructors") using the Learner Pass Pty Ltd ("LearnerPass") booking platform ("Platform").


1.2. The Code covers:


1.2.1. Platform usage

1.2.2. All subsequent lessons

1.2.3. All interactions with learner drivers ("Learners") sourced through the Platform


1.3. By using the Platform, Instructors explicitly agree to comply with this Code of Conduct.

4. Legal Compliance


4.1. Instructors must comply with all applicable federal, state, and local laws where they operate, including but not limited to:


4.2. Licensing and Accreditation:


4.2.1. Maintaining a valid driver's licence

4.2.2. Holding a current instructor's licence

4.2.3. Possessing an up-to-date working with children check

4.2.4. Having a current national police check

4.2.5. Keeping all other required accreditations current


4.3. Traffic Laws:


4.3.1. Following all road rules and regulations

4.3.2. Adhering to speed limits

4.3.3. Complying with parking restrictions

4.3.4. Obeying all traffic signs and signals


4.4. Vehicle Requirements:


4.4.1. Ensuring the vehicle is fully registered

4.4.2. Maintaining the vehicle in a roadworthy condition

4.4.3. Keeping the vehicle clean and presentable

4.4.4. Equipping the vehicle with all necessary safety features



5. Professional Conduct


Instructors shall:


5.1. Demeanor:


5.1.1. Maintain a courteous and professional demeanor at all times

5.1.2. Interact respectfully with Learners, prospective clients, LearnerPass staff, and all other individuals


5.2. Instruction:


5.2.1. Provide the full duration of instruction as booked by the Learner

5.2.2. Give Learners undivided attention during the entire lesson period

5.2.3. Focus solely on providing quality instruction


5.3. Communication:


5.3.1. Promptly notify affected Learners via the LearnerPass platform if unable to complete a scheduled lesson

5.3.2. Provide clear reasons for any cancellations or changes

5.3.3. Offer options for rescheduling or connecting with an alternative Instructor


5.4. Payment:


5.4.1. Only claim payment through the Platform after the lesson has been fully completed

5.4.2. Accurately report the duration and nature of services provided


5.5. Quality of Instruction:


5.5.1. Deliver competent, high-quality driving instruction to the best of their ability

5.5.2. Consistently set a positive example through their own driving practices

5.5.3. Regularly update knowledge of road rules, safe driving practices, and instructional techniques


5.6. Punctuality and Preparation:


5.6.1. Arrive punctually for all scheduled lessons

5.6.2. Allow sufficient time for proper lesson preparation

5.6.3. Ensure all necessary materials and equipment are ready before the lesson begins


5.7. Record Keeping:


5.7.1. Keep accurate and up-to-date records of all lessons conducted

5.7.2. Maintain detailed progress notes for each Learner

5.7.3. Securely store all Learner-related information in compliance with privacy laws



6. Prohibited Conduct


Instructors must not:


6.1. Behavior:


6.1.1. Engage in any form of offensive behavior

6.1.2. Display discriminatory attitudes or actions

6.1.3. Use abusive language or conduct

6.1.4. Act in an unprofessional manner towards Learners, LearnerPass staff, or any other individuals


6.2. Distractions:


6.2.1. Use mobile phones while providing driving instruction

6.2.2. Smoke in the vehicle at any time

6.2.3. Eat or drink while providing instruction

6.2.4. Engage in any activity that may distract from the lesson


6.3. Unauthorised Persons:


6.3.1. Allow unauthorised third parties to be present in the vehicle during lessons

6.3.2. Exception: When explicit consent has been obtained in advance from the Learner (or their parent/guardian for minors)


6.4. Payments:


6.4.1. Accept any form of payment or benefit from a Learner outside of the LearnerPass Platform

6.4.2. Offer discounts or incentives for direct bookings


6.5. Misrepresentation:


6.5.1. Misrepresent themselves as employees, representatives, or agents of LearnerPass

6.5.2. Provide false or misleading information about qualifications, experience, or services offered


6.6. Privacy and Data Protection:


6.6.1. Disclose any personal information about Learners to third parties without express written consent, except to a Government agency or authorised examiner for the purposes of booking a driving test 

6.6.2. Use a Learner's personal information for any purpose other than providing driving instruction or booking tests


6.7. Recording:


6.7.1. Take photographs, videos, or recordings of Learners without their explicit consent (or that of their parent/guardian for minors)

6.7.2. Exception: In-car dash-cam front and cabin recordings as required by law


6.8. Competition:


6.8.1. Attempt to poach Learners from LearnerPass for private instruction

6.8.2. Recommend competing services to Learners


6.9. Harassment:


6.9.1. Engage in any behavior that could be perceived as harassment

6.9.2. Make unwanted physical contact

6.9.3. Use inappropriate comments or jokes

6.9.4. Conduct themselves in a way that could reasonably offend, humiliate, or intimidate others


6.10. Vehicle Condition:


6.10.1. Conduct lessons in a vehicle that is not properly maintained

6.10.2. Use a vehicle that is not registered for instructional purposes

6.10.3. Operate a vehicle that is not adequately insured for driving instruction



7. Non-Discrimination


7.1. Instructors shall not discriminate against any person based on protected attributes including but not limited to:


7.1.1. Age

7.1.2. Disability status

7.1.3. Gender identity

7.1.4. Marital status

7.1.5. Race

7.1.6. Religion

7.1.7. Sex

7.1.8. Sexual orientation


7.2. Instructors must provide equal service and opportunities to all Learners, regardless of their background or characteristics.



8. Harassment Prevention


8.1. Instructors must not engage in any form of harassment, including but not limited to:


8.1.1. Sexual harassment

8.1.2. Verbal harassment

8.1.3. Physical harassment

8.1.4. Psychological harassment


8.2. Prohibited conduct includes:


8.2.1. Unwelcome physical contact

8.2.2. Inappropriate comments or jokes

8.2.3. Any conduct that could reasonably offend, humiliate, or intimidate others


8.3. Instructors must maintain professional boundaries at all times.



9. Safety Responsibilities


Instructors shall:


9.1. Legal Compliance:


9.1.1. Comply with all applicable work health and safety laws

9.1.2. Adhere to road safety regulations and best practices


9.2. Risk Management:


9.2.1. Take reasonable precautions to ensure their own safety

9.2.2. Ensure the safety of Learners during instruction

9.2.3. Properly manage risks associated with in-vehicle instruction


9.3. Vehicle Safety:


9.3.1. Regularly inspect and maintain the instruction vehicle

9.3.2. Ensure all safety features are functional

9.3.3. Address any safety concerns immediately


9.4. Emergency Preparedness:


9.4.1. Have a clear emergency action plan

9.4.2. Know how to respond to various road emergencies

9.4.3. Keep emergency contact information readily available



By agreeing to this Code of Conduct, Instructors commit to upholding these standards in all their interactions and activities related to the LearnerPass Platform.
